Is it permissible to memorize the Qur’an with the intention of it being an ongoing charity (Sadaqah Jariyah) on behalf of a deceased mother?
The reward for charity and supplication for the deceased reaches them. Enduring charity is an endowment (Waqf), which means holding the principal and dedicating its usufruct. Memorizing the Quran is not an enduring charity, but it is a righteous deed, and it is permissible to dedicate its reward to the deceased.
